    Animenut1 -> RE: =AQ= Final Solstice Saga Finale (5/29/2026 13:42:01)

    quote:

    if anyone buys the token equipment, please post a review.


    The armor feels...meh. I usually use FO armors, so switching to an FD armor is obviously going to mean less damage, but eve considering that, the armor feels weak. Spamming Horror is a good way to inflict panic and burn, but it's still, y'know, burn damage. It's low damage compared to actual attacks. And attacks don't feel all that strong, either. Against the training drakel, Devastation (unbuffed) was only dealing like 500 damage. A standard fire skill used by a fire armor and it barely does anything. Getting the burn to anywhere near 400% takes a lot of spamming and still didn't seem to affect the damage (At all, it seemed. A bug?), but even if it DID deal 5x damage and averaged 2000+ damage against a 100% resist enemy, that requires many turns of trivial damage and lots of SP to eventually get, since Horror itself doesn't deal legitimate damage.

    Devastation: Standard (Armor element) skill, deals more damage by consuming enemy burn, up to 400%. Requires too much setup for too much cost and not enough damage. A costly nuke that doesn't nuke.

    Havoc: Above-standard (Armor element) skill. If enemy is panicked, it has a standard SP cost and a chance to heal a little on hit. Doesn't heal much, and damage is comparable to unbuffed Devastation.

    Horror: Efficient (Armor element) skill. Deals 1 damage per two hits. Attempts to panic/burn monster.

    If Horror actually DID damage, this might be salvageable as a decent fire armor. Devastation might be bugged since even near max burn, the damage is still unimpressive. It seems to only eat 100% burn, though, despite what the tooltip implies. The armor's Initiative bonus doesn't really matter since it relies on status infliction and won't meaningfully get any use from the turn-1 damage buff. The most you'd get from that is getting to act first with 0LUK.

    The weapon does NOT inflict passive burns. Click the weapon to spend standard SP and use a 2-hit skill that inflicts an HP and SP Light burn on the enemy for 4 rounds each. The SP burn seems to rooouuuughly average about 40SP per tick. Not a bad weapon. Has some niche utility.

    The SHIELD, though, is quite interesting. Light shield, blocking attacks makes enemies Panic. More Panic infliction if they are burned. This pairs PHENOMENALLY with Paladin armor (best Light armor in the game). It's Light, so it matches up there, and lets Paladin passively inflict Panic without needing to use the 98SP toggle. Want to super-panic an enemy? Toggle Panic attacks and double up on Panic infliction with the shield. Want to Panic AND Burn? No need to use the costly 196SP toggle. Just toggle the 98SP Burn to inflict both. AND the Panic will be stronger thanks to the Burn toggle. Want to absolutely WITHER the enemy? 196SP Panic/Burn toggle WITH the shield. And because of Paladin's lean manipulation, you can use it however you want without being locked to FD.

    The shield honestly pairs well with a lot of Darkness warrior armors that focus on evasion, like Shadowfall Raiment and True Nemesis' Testament. Evade, proc the Panic, repeat. The Light element of the shield makes fighting Light enemies less risky, and the Panic effect only further helps that along.
